Position Summary:
Seeking candidates with long tenured work history to control and monitor supplier quality parts and systems to drive continuous improvement in an automotive manufacturing environment.
Essential Functions:
- Implement the quality activities for the assigned area (Body, Chassis, Electrical, or Trim).
- Perform the planned activities for part approval and improvement efficiently and effectively.
- Monitor vendors to supply high-quality parts to production lines continuously.
- Review and interpret statistical information and reports in order to draw conclusions regarding current production efficiency and quality.
- Understand and support part quality assurance system.
- Claim defective parts from suppliers and request improvements.
- Monitor Technical Support personnel.
- Write detailed reports on quality issues.
- Communicate effectively at various levels within the organization.
- Communicate effectively with internal and external customers and suppliers.
- Administer, coordinate, and comply with all Business Management System (BMS), Environmental Management System (EMS), and Safety Management System (SMS) requirements.
- Meet all other requirements as assigned.
